Family-Friendly Rating

A family-friendly apartment community may be just the ticket if you have children when you rent. This part of town ranks as a favorite neighborhood for families, with a score of 4.0 out of 4. Family Friendly neighborhoods have features that support parents and kids in having fun and being healthy together. These features include things like green spaces, trails and recreation, and access to the best-regarded education opportunities for the kids to attend.
